What might 1 BRACKNEL WAY be worth now?

1 BRACKNEL WAY might now be worth an estimated £532,018.

This is based on house price inflation of 42.8%, between July 2007 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the West Lancashire local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 42.8%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 1 BRACKNEL WAY of £372,500 on 16th July 2007. For the value to have increased from £372,500 to £532,018 over the eighteen years and five months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 1 BRACKNEL WAY has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the West Lancashire local authority area.
  • The July 2007 sale price of £372,500 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 1 BRACKNEL WAY has not materially changed since July 2007.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.
